TransUnion (TRU), a global provider of credit information, risk assessment, and analytics solutions, is trading at $69.14 as of April 6, 2026, marking a 0.26% decline from the previous session’s close. In recent weeks, the stock has traded in a relatively tight range, drawing attention from technical traders and institutional investors monitoring key price thresholds for potential shifts in momentum.
